Conveniently located, close to schools, shops, transport, parks, Ashfield Pool and other amenities. * One bedroom with built-ins * Separate living * Enclosed sunroom * Near-new carpet * New kitchen * New bathroom * New internal laundry * 1st Floor * Convenient to amenities The Details * 12 months lease * Available now The neighbourhood: The suburb's proximity to the CBD makes it a professional hotspot, and commuting is easy. The railway station offers express trains to the city
- it's two stops to Central
- and there are bus services to Burwood, Bondi Junction and Drummoyne. Ashfield has a vibrant multicultural community, and foodies refer to it as the Chinatown of the inner west. Liverpool Road is the main commercial precinct
- it's home to a slew of shops, restaurants, and grocery stores, including many Asian ones, as well as Ashfield Mall. (Source
